B9 JNH is a 2014 Jaguar Xf in Red with a 2,179c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2014 Jaguar Xf models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.8% with a typical mileage of 62,064 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jaguar Xf f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 16,779 recorded failures. If you're considering buying B9 JNH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jaguar Xf typ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 12 years old, this Jaguar Xf is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
